Cataract Surgery
A cataract is the lens of the eye that has lost its clarity. In a cataract operation, this lens is surgically removed, and replaced with an artificial lens implant in order to restore vision. The latest techniqes in small-incision cataract surgery are performed by our surgeons.
Glaucoma Management and Surgery
Glaucoma is a potentially blinding disease. When the pressure within the eye is elevated to such a level that results in nerve damage, vision is irretrievably lost. Glaucoma medications, laser and surgery can control the pressure within the eye and prevent further nerve damage. Diabetic Eye Disease
Diabetes is the #1 cause of blindness in the United States for adults under 65 years of age. Diabetes can cause permanent retina damage, resulting in lost vision. In addition, diabetics are more prone to cataract formation and glaucoma. Our physicians are experts in diagnosing and treating diabetic eye disease.
